Description
Have you wished on occasion to be clearer about the difference between Singleness and Singularity and Uniqueness and Oneness? Have you ever wondered why the aʿyān never smelt a whiff of the scent of existence even though their love had begun while they were still in the Blindness? Would you like to make better sense of phrases such as: “This relationship which is the result of the two natures is nothing other than a relationship, not of relativity but of mentation and concept?” Have you longed to dispel some of the uncertainties surrounding the subtle distinction between the Joining of the Two Arcs and the station of Or Nearer? If any of these questions has occurred to you, it is quite likely that you will find this seminar informative and interesting. If none of them has, this seminar may seem to you too technical.
Our course facilitator, Avi Abadi, has been studying the teachings of Ibn ‘Arabi, and the Fusus al-Hikam in particular, for over forty years.

Online study of The Kernel of the Kernel, a selection of key passages from Muhyiddin Ibn ‘Arabi’s Futūḥāt al-Makkiyyah, translated into Turkish with commentary by Ismail Hakki Bursevi (1652-1728AD). Translated into English by Bulent Rauf.

This course provides a full introduction to the principles of Beshara in terms of both knowledge and practice. Taking the metaphysics of Muhyiddin Ibn ‘Arabi as a starting point, the course explores what it means to know oneself and the world in the light of the Unity of Existence.
